How Companion Care Supports Independent Living

The presence of a compassionate caregiver encourages independence while providing the right amount of help. Companion care assists individuals in completing essential tasks without making them feel dependent. Trained staff members can accompany individuals to appointments, social outings, or even just help with meal planning and light housekeeping. This balance enables people to stay active in their communities and maintain a routine. The structure provided through companionship fosters emotional stability and keeps daily life manageable.

The Role of Conversation and Engagement

Social interaction plays a key role in maintaining cognitive function and emotional stability. Caregivers who offer companionship often engage in conversations, games, reading, and shared activities that stimulate the mind. These interactions help reduce the effects of memory loss, encourage mental clarity, and offer a comforting sense of normalcy. Over time, many clients develop a strong bond with their companion, creating a sense of trust and familiarity. This relationship contributes to a more joyful, purpose-filled daily life.

What is companion care in home health services?
Companion care involves non-medical assistance that focuses on providing emotional support, socialization, and help with daily tasks to promote independence and comfort at home.
Who can benefit from companion care services?
Older adults, individuals recovering from illness or surgery, or those living with disabilities who experience loneliness or need help with non-clinical tasks may benefit from companion care.
How does companion care differ from personal care?
While both services offer in-home support, companion care is centered on social interaction and help with light tasks, whereas personal care may include hands-on assistance with hygiene or mobility.
Can companion care include transportation?
Yes, many companion caregivers can assist with non-emergency transportation to appointments, social visits, and errands as part of their role.
Is companion care available for clients who do not need medical attention?
Yes, companion care is specifically designed for individuals who need support and interaction but do not require ongoing medical or clinical care.
Does companion care help with memory or cognitive conditions?
While it is not medical treatment, companion care can help improve mental stimulation and emotional well-being for individuals with early-stage memory or cognitive challenges.
How often can companion care be scheduled?
Companion care can be arranged on a flexible schedule, whether a few hours a week or 24-hour supervision, depending on the client’s needs.
